Grant Thornton Stax congratulates Ares Management and its portfolio company, Automated Industrial Robotics Inc. (AIR), on its recent acquisition of KAON Automation, an Ireland-based industrial automation company that delivers advanced automation solutions for leading manufacturing companies globally. We are proud to have supported Ares and AIR with our investment advisory services in this successful transaction. ​

Founded in 2005 and headquartered in Sligo, Ireland, KAON has built a strong reputation for delivering highly customized automation solutions to medical and life sciences manufacturers, particularly in regulated production environments. The company specializes in designing and integrating automated production lines using modular system architectures that support flexible, scalable, and repeatable manufacturing. KAON is known for its expertise in intelligent conveyor systems, enabling high-throughput operations where precision, consistency, and uptime are critical.​

Leveraging experience in central transport platforms and aseptic filling, KAON has also developed next-generation solutions that combine high-speed filling with zero-touch changeover. With a focus on technical excellence and innovation, KAON partners with leading component suppliers to deliver high-quality, efficient automation systems that enhance productivity while helping customers optimize capital investment.​
